    Daniel Robert Snow MBE (born 3 December 1978) is a British popular historian and television presenter. He is an ambassador of the Electoral Reform Society (ERS). Early life and education.

    Dan Snow was born on 3 December 1978 in London, England, UK. He is a writer and producer, known for The Christmas Truce (2020), Imphal & Kohima: Britain's Greatest Battle (2018) and Untitled (discovery of sunken Endurance ship near Antarctica). He has been married to Edwina Louise Grosvenor since 2010. They have three children.
